What is an Online MBA?

An Online MBA (Master of Business Administration) is a graduate-level degree program that allows students to study business management remotely. These programs are offered by accredited universities and provide the same value as traditional on-campus MBAs.

Accreditation Bodies in USA

Choosing an accredited program is essential. Top accreditation organizations include:

  • AACSB (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business)
  • ACBSP (Accreditation Council for Business Schools and Programs)
  • IACBE (International Accreditation Council for Business Education)

Accreditation ensures quality education and employer recognition.


Admission Requirements

1. Bachelor’s Degree

From a recognized institution.

2. Work Experience

Typically 1–5 years preferred.

3. GMAT/GRE Scores

Some universities waive this requirement.

4. English Proficiency

TOEFL/IELTS for international students.

5. Resume & Statement of Purpose

Highlights career goals and achievements.


Cost of Online MBA in USA

  • Low-cost programs: $10,000 – $25,000
  • Mid-range programs: $25,000 – $60,000
  • Top-tier programs: $60,000 – $120,000+

Costs vary based on university and specialization.


Duration of Online MBA Programs

  • Full-time: 1–2 years
  • Part-time: 2–4 years
  • Accelerated programs: 12–18 months
